RESOLUTION 1522
A RESOLUTION OF THE PLANNING COMMISSION
OF THE CITY OF SEAL BEACH REPORTING
REGARDING THE CONFORMITY WITH THE
GENERAL PLAN OF PROPOSED AMENDMENT NO. 4
TO THE REDEVELOPMENT PLAN FOR THE
RIVERFRONT REDEVELOPMENT PROJECT
The Planning Commission of the City of Seal Beach does hereby
find, determine, resolve and order as follows:
Section 1. The Redevelopment Agency of the City of Seal Beach
has submitted proposed Amendment No. 4 to the Redevelopment Plan
for the Riverfront Redevelopment Project, attached hereto as
Exhibi t A, to the Planning Commission for its report regarding
the conformity of such proposed Amendment No. 4 with the General
Plan of the City of Seal Beach and its recommendations regarding
such proposed Amendment No.4.
section 2. The location, purpose and extent of (i) real property
to be acquired by dedication or otherwise for street, square,
park or other public purposes, (ii) real property to be disposed
of, (iii) streets to be vacated or abandoned, (iv) public
buildings or structures to be constructed or authorized, all
pursuant to or in furtherance of such proposed Amendment NO.4,
are in conformance with the General Plan.
section 3. Such proposed Amendment No. 4 is in conformance with
the General Plan.
section 4. Pursuant to section 15168 of the CEQA guidelines, a
Program EIR (87-1) for the Hellman Specific Plan, has been
prepared and certified by the City of Seal Beach and this
Amendment No. 4 is within the scope of the certified Program EIR,
which adequately described the general environmental setting of
the project, its significant environmental impacts and
alternatives, and mitigation measures related to each significant
environmental effect, and that no additional environmental
documentation is needed.
section 5. That a Environmental Impact Report was prepared and
certified by the City of Seal Beach for the Department of Water
and Power site in June 1983, which address the adopted Specific
Plan and zoning, and this EIR described the general environmental
setting of the project, its significant environmental impacts and
alternatives, and mitigation measures related to each significant
environmental effect, and that the proposed Amendment No.4 is
within the scope of the program approved earlier, and that no
additional environmental documentation is needed, in accordance
with section 21166 of the California Environmental Ouality Act.
Section a. The Planning Commission hereby recommends approval of
such proposed amendments by the Agency and by the city Council of
the City of Seal Beach.
